Anthony Joshua celebrates heavyweight titles with Buhari in UK
The World Heavyweight Champion, Anthony Joshua, in London, the United Kingdom, met with President Muhammadu Buhari where he presented his IBF, WBA, WBO, and IBO titles to the Nigerian leader.
Anthony Joshua met with President at a forum of the Nigerian leader with Nigerians living in the United Kingdom.
The world champion took selfie pictures with President Buhari at the forum.
Present at the forum were Governor Inuwa Yahaya of Gombe State, Minister of Foreign Affairs, Geoffrey Onyeama; Minister of Trade and Investment, Adeniyi Adebayo; Chairman/CEO of the Nigerians in Diaspora Commission, Abike Dabiri-Erewa; and Nigeria’s High Commissioner to the UK, Justice Adesola Oguntade, among others.
Joshua defeated Andy Ruiz to reclaim his IBF, WBA and WBO titles on December 7, 2019, in Saudi Arabia.
Joshua lost his titles to Ruiz in a shocking knockout defeat in New York, USA, in June 2019, but defeated Ruiz on majority points of 118-110 on two scorecards with the third judge making it 119-109 to reclaim the titles.
